Therapeutic efficacy of home-based long-term cerebellar transcranial direct current stimulation on cerebellar ataxia

Randomized, double-blinded, multi-center, prospective clinical trial for therapeutic efficacy of home-based long-term cerebellar transcranial direct current stimulation on cerebellar ataxia

Interventions

Medical Device : For 23 cerebellar ataxia patients assigned to real stimulation group, cerebellar tDCS (2mA) is delivered for 20 minutes/day for 84 consecutive days (12 weeks). For 23 cerebellar atax

Inclusion criteria

Inclusion criteria: 1. Age ranging from 30 to 69 years old 2. Patients with cerebellar ataxia, diagnosed as multisystem atrophy-cerebellar type, spinocerebellar ataxia, idiopathic late onset cerebellar ataxia 3. K-MMSE >=24 4. Unassisted gait (for more than 10 m) 5. Voluntarily signed up for the clinical trial

Exclusion criteria

Exclusion criteria: 1. Presence of medical or neurological disorders, or head trauma history 2. Presence of cognitive dysfunction affecting the ability to understand informed consent or perform the clinical trial 3. Presence of any suicidal idea or psychiatric disorders 4. Contraindication for tDCS (e.g. metallic device inserted in head) 5. Presence of skin problem hindering electrode adherence 6. Possibility of pregnancy 7. Pregnant state 8. Other reasons that are considered unsuitable for study enrollment

Design outcomes

Primary

MeasureTime frame
International Cooperative Ataxia Rating Scale (ICARS)

Secondary

MeasureTime frame
temporospatial parameters from GAITRite/Pedoscan;Montreal Cognitive Assessment/Korean Cerebellar Cognitive Affective/Schmahmann Syndrome scale (MoCA/K-CCAS);Beck Depression Inventory/Beck Anxiety Inventory (BDI/BAI);connectivity/integrity parameters from functional MR/diffusion tensor image;after-effect of tDCS (ICARS, GAITRite/Pedoscan, MoCA/K-CCAS, BAI/BDI);safety evaluation (adverse event)
